Method of communication between reduced functionality devices in an IEEE 802.15.4 network
First Claim
1. A method of enhancing communication in a communication network, the method comprising the steps of:
- providing at least one full functional device (FFD) having a transceiver operable to receive and send messages using radio frequency;
providing a plurality of reduced functionality devices (RFDs) each having a transceiver operable to receive and transmit messages using radio frequency, wherein each of the RFDs is assigned to only one FFD;
activating each RFD during a predetermined activation period, wherein each RFD communicates to its assigned FFD upon initial activation;
determining whether the communication from the activated RFD to the assigned FFD has been established, wherein the activated RFD enters an orphaned state upon the failure to communicate with the assigned FFD;
continuing to operate the transceiver of the activated RFD to receive messages from either the assigned FFD or the other RFDs when the activated RFD is in the orphaned state; and
allowing the activated RFD to respond to the messages received from the other RFDs only when the activated RFD is in the orphaned state.

Abstract
In a 802.15.4 network, each reduced functionality device (RFD) is permitted to communicate with only an assigned full function device (FFD). The present invention allows each of the RFDs to communicate with another RFD upon the RFD determining that the local FFD assigned to the RFD is inoperable or unable to communicate. Under emergency conditions, the RFD is able to communicate with a closely located RFDs such that the closely located RFDs can receive and respond to an emergency situation and/or repeat the message. To satisfy the 802.15.4 standards, communication between the RFDs is allowed only during emergency conditions and when the FFD is inoperative. A comprehensive test procedure is included to insure the integrity of the system is preserved at all times.
